Hi:
I would like to put some text in front of my page numbers in the footer of each page. - e.g.: FooBar / Page 1 FooBar / Page 2 etc. The prepended text in this example is "FooBar / Page ". I also want this text to appear (together with the page number) in the table of contents (TOC). - e.g.: Chapter Title ............. FooBar / Page 1 Can someone please tell me how to do this in Microsoft Word 2003?
